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Normand

Новачок
  
  • Публікації

    26
  • З нами

  • Відвідування

Усі публікації користувача Normand

  1. спасибо! но там есть кастомные моменты которые нужно предусмотреть, и к стати не нашел на его странице этого модуля.
  2. спасибо всем мне это нужно для создания тега <meta property="og:image" ну собственно получить нужно главную картинку продукта и засунуть ее туда. А она должна идти до </head>
  3. Привет всем! версия: 2.3.0.2 Хочу обратиться к массиву $images но в header.tpl. Доступен он только в product.tpl как это сделать? Спасибо
  4. Уважаемый формчанин, мне уже написали в личку несколько человек, все сразу поняли, что требуется, и только ваша персона требует не только пояснений, но и образование заказчика. Прощайте.
  5. >Сколько бы вы взяли на за натяжку одной страницы (пускай будет главная) на OpenCart? это и есть пример данной работы
  6. Требуется доработать OpenCart: - натянуть шаблоны - допилить то, что начал старый программист и не закончил: короткая корзина, вывод товара с спец опциями ... вобщем работы очень много, и постоянно надо что то исправлять добавлять ... Работать будем поэтапно. Делаем что либо - оплата. От вас: на срывать сроки не требовать предоплаты, оплата после проверки результата быть ответственным ----- Ну и сразу контрольный вопрос: Сколько бы вы взяли на за натяжку одной страницы (пускай будет главная) на OpenCart? Пожалуйста пишите сразу цену за пример данной работы!
  7. Оплачу консультацию программиста, хочу написать собственный модуль к opencart небольшой. Нужно совместно спроектировать его грамотно, далее я буду сам писать и обращаться к вам за консультацией если что то будет не понятно. Оплачивая каждую!
  8. Вобщем задача которую хочу решить, только не надо предлагать модуль симпл. Карта поведения юзера должна быть такой: клик на кнопке "купить сейчас" добавление в корзину с ридеректом сразу на страницу ввода данных: адрес, ФИО и емайл. // регистрация не нужна юзера - страница приема адреса после нажатия кнопки "готово" на "страница приема адреса" пишем в базу заказ как постпей те мне надо переопределить собственно контроллер корзины, чтоб там шел сразу ридерект 302 на урл который будет вызывать, который будет вызывать нужный контроллер и метод. $this->cart->getProducts(); На странице моего модуля собираем нужные поля + корзину, и пишем его в базу заказов после нажатия кнопки ... далее пишем спасибо? Как грамотно сделать я не могу понять, помогите написать пару тройку первых расширений пожалуйста. Просто не понимаю с чего начать даже ... растерялся Как начать это переопределение ... с чего начать
  9. Привет всем! Помогите пожалуйста найти блоксхему opencart 2, ну должна же она существовать :). Нужно понять как работает детально корзина. Спасибо!
  10. что за модуль? можете скрином показать пожалуйста
  11. Да скорость возрастает, причем прилично ... и тут я даже читал на форуме, что opencart не использует возможностей php7 ... это от части не верно, оптимизация была именно на уровне работы любого вида кода на php, например сильно сократилось потребление памяти и тд. На 7 я запускал ни каких варнингов не увидел особо. А вот да ionCube - это сразу алис, приехали Dotrox прав. Так что если у вас есть покупные модули с ionCube, даже не думайте.
  12. Не так давно ругался с верстальщиком именно по этому вопросу. Он мне все изображения сунул как адаптивные, что я считаю не есть хорошо. поясню почему. Вы хотите чтоб ваш клиент сидя в метро или в автобусе, где скорость постоянно скачет туда сюда и каждый Кб ждет когда же загрузится ваше адаптивное изображение. Но товар настолько ценен и он не дождавшись загрузки идет домой, открывает там ваш сайт и снова пытается посмотреть ... ну сценарий из области фантастики скорее всего. По этому я требовал от верстальщика, чтоб было нарезано 3 разные группы изображений, а самые мелкие были вбиты в base64. Тем самым шансы, что человек ткнет пальцем, купить именно сейчас намного выше чем через какой то промежуток времени. По этому советую продумать этот момент изначально. Думаю тут все в лень упирается. Я все к тому, что будьте осторожнее с адаптивностью изображений на мобилках.
  13. Немного офтоп, сори ... Вообще задумался над таким вопросом как кол-во продуктов с той ил иной опцией, вот есть скажем у нас стандартная схема опциональности продукта. Ну цвета: красный и желтый. Хорошо ... будем отталкиваться от отчетности в opencart которая идет по дефолту, как там выводить остальные поля я не нашел. Если в продукт задать опцию цвета, и сказать, что вот желтых скажем 5 штук а черных 8 штук. То он все равно будет ориентироваться по другому полю, по основному, вот как вбито в него 7 штук так он и будет показывать эти 7. И я ведь ни как не увижу что скажем кончается у меня желтые майки или там других каких то цветов, хоть и забивал кол-во оных при создании опций данного продукта. Вот как было 7 штук так и будет показывать их. Возможно я не прав и прост не умею строить отчеты в opencart, но я отталкиваюсь от дефолтного склада, что каждая единица товара не имеет опции а имеет четкое свое кол-во. тогда получается нужно добавлять товар как не опция, а как единица. Те : 5 желтых отдельно и 8 черных отдельно, не как опции как единицы товара. тогда все встает на свои места, а вывод "опциональности" превращается в вывод какого то json списка - конкретной модели "Product 3" но имеющие свои отличия только в цветах. Поправьте меня пожалуйста если я не прав, а то все пытаюсь сразу учесть и складские головные боли и бухгалтерские.
  14. Практический смыл как раз и заключается, что люди часто попросту в последствии пишут, ой вы мне прислали не ту футболку ... на фото к примеру она красная, то получу именно ее, а оказывается надо было кликать еще и на кружочках. Очень много таких покупателей оказалось у меня, и вот как раз эта опция это все решила. >Для реализации нужен отдельный тип опции, или можно использовать, к примеру тип "Изображения"? Ну вот к стати я и попробовал использовать выше опцию изображения, если я верно ее понял, + вписал значение цвета в названии. В престо конечно система опциональности немного сильнее в этом отношении - именно по цветам, те можно выбрать и картинку и сам цвет, а уже потом вывести там и как хочешь раскидать скриптом своим. Те не хватает к цвету еще загрузки картинки.
  15. Это дублирование выбора цвета, те человек может выбрать цвет посредством скажем визуальных кругов: синий, красный и тд ... либо он может кликнуть по уменьшеной картинке, и будет выбран нужный цвет. Ну например кликает по зеленой футболке маленькой, соответственно выбирается зеленая футболка, кликает по зеленому кругу выбирается опять же зеленая футболка. Дублирование функционала получается. После того как цвет выбран, это пойдет как опция к товару при его заказе. Т.е. в последствии ка кто надо понимать, что заказали именно зеленую футболку, а не черную которая по умолчанию. Как я смог себе представить это: создаю опцию товара, обзываю ее как нужно, в данном случае Circle Color потом захожу в опцию и добавляю здесь цвет майки как red + фото мелкое. Ну как бы почти готово, далее я иду на страницу самого товара и выбираю для его эту опцию. Ну и после уже дело JS скриптом раскидать и версткой эту опцию для товара. Ну а цвет я буду кругляшек ловить скорее всего из alt картинки и подставлять background:red; Ну получается, что мне нужно будет ходить и генерировать в списке опций для каждого отдельного товара свою опцию. Но все как то костыльно и грубо получается. А если я захочу скажем передать FFFDDD цвет, а чере месяц у меня буде список такого бреда в опциях под одноименными названиями. Короче походу это будет мое первое дополнение
  16. Всем привет! Есть такая задача, нужен модуль в котором можно было бы указывать опции товара: цвет (именно чтоб можно было указывать в виде визуального круга или квадрата ... нужные цвета) фото товара с цветом нужным цветом - уменьшенная копия Схематично примерно выглядит так как на прикрепленном изображении. Те чтоб был дублирующий функционал выбора цветов товара. Я нашел вот такое, но оно дает работать только выбором цвета в виде круга или квадрата, но не фото. Может кто то видел такое дополнение, которое дает это делать так как мне нужно. Спасибо!
  17. да мне не особо интересно это делать, я имею ввиду: копать кешь MYSQL - эти слова я услышал от своего админа, который посмотрел профилирование и предложил решение, оно как бы и должно быть. Я не админ по этому - се ляви :). Если вам интересно я могу спросить его более подробно, чем он и как намерен это сделать, но я думаю вы сами это представляете. Статья предложена в "песочнице", а не в разделе программирования или еще где либо, и предполагает расширение кругозора, с формулировкой: Как ускорить ваш фронтенд. Где вы тут усмотрели opencart? Этот топик не претендует на цель хейтинга, наоборот, я просто хотел поделиться информацией с людьми, которым в априори это будет интересно, так как от их работы зависит прибыль проектов. У вас на магазин сколько трафика сваливается? 1к в сутки? Как вы это контролируете, в плане если пришло одновременно 100 юзеров вы просите кого то подождать, или как? Мне кажется нужно быть готовым к каким то всплескам, и уметь работать с ними за благовременно, те на стадии создания проекта. Чем потом исправлять ошибки и искать где что режет, для этого и написана была данная статья, как мне кажется. Но в любом случае я не кого не учу, просто делюсь найденой интересной информацией, в надежде быть полезным сообществу.
  18. тестировал к стати его, возможно плохо разобрался, но почему то снижал мне скорость загрузки страниц, в плане отдачи первого байта. Так и не понял почему, вернее копаться не стал даже. И логику не понял, при рефреше почему то код всегда разный то он картинки в base64 сует то не сует ... вобщем загадочная какая то техника если честно :). Но для оптимизации чужого шаблона, который изначально кривой и напичкан кучей всяческих сторонних либ, пойдет. Но для педантов точно не вариант. ну за модуль конечно спасибо большое. Но он и так отдает быстро достаточно, его погоняю в том числе. Я думал до вашего сообщения остановиться на Memcached + кешь самого MYSQL.
  19. Меня очень порадовало комьюнити спасибо всем кто отписал в этой ветке! Редко такое бывает ...
  20. Простите админы, но я не знаю где такое писать... вобщем кому интересно, а оно должно быть вам интересно вот статейка, сегодня только пришла по подписке. Как ускорить ваш фронтенд. Ну там конечно я бы еще добавил несколько вещей базовых, но в любом случае почитать интересно будет для тех кто понимает, что такое удовлетворенный клиент :), звучит блин как то пошло ... ну да ладно.
  21. Да не то чтобы хочется прям писать, просто я пытаюсь найти вариант который в кротчайшие сроки мне даст нужный результат. Например на моем кастомном решении я добился загрузки всей товарной страницы всего за 800млс с того региона под который был нужен, ADSL. Ну да возможно это не совсем корректное сравнение, но скажу так первый байт отдается менее чем за 50млс, тогда как например преста жрет порядка 499млс, вчера померил Opencart ... 299млс. Ну я профилирование посмотрел, там больше всего сжирает MYSQL. Думаю это можно настроить - поигравшись с кеширование самого MYSQL. Вобщем я не перфекционист, просто знаю, что каждая секунда погрузки выбивает прибыль из проекта, а это крайне важно. По этому я и сделал сразу старт именно с своего решения, а сейчас да. Компаньоны просят уже админку, плюс интеграцию надо делать с бухгалтерией. Вот и начал изучать сторонние решения, так ка понимаю, что писать с нуля такие вещи ну просто глупо. собственно чем сейчас и занят Спасибо большое свяжусь с автором модуля, для обсуждения решения моей задачи на его базе. да вы правы, сложноватая. еще и туда сюда их колбасит, сейчас на симфонию ее сажают как люди там будут переходит на такое кардинально новое решение не совсем понимаю. Вобщем перестройка не всегда хорошо Спасибо всем еще раз ответы!
  22. Всем здравствуйте! Сижу сейчас на самописной версии подобия шопа :), пришел к тому, что нужно нормальная админка и нормально добавление товара, а не через консоль как это делаю сейчас. Смотрел presto - сложно, пришел к opencart - пока копаю. Подскажите пожалуйста мне нужно решение. От куда лучше копать чтоб уже начать делать. 1. Нужна страница товара с своим шаблоном, ну от части понятно рыть в сторону шаблонов и менять там страницу именно продукта 2. Каким образом сокращать количество шагов до заказа. Зашел на страницу товара, кликнул заказать, страница ввода адреса, без страны ... без регистрации какой либо ... только свои поля в своем дизайне, нажимает заказать. Все считаем заказ оформлен с доставкой через постпей. 3. Оптимизация: есть ли вообще варианты оптимизации на уровне самого движка, или только через настройку кеширования MYSQL запросов ...? 4. Есть что то из этого на русском? Так - для расширения кругозора, и чтоб много лишних вопросов не задавать. Касательного второго вопроса, это модуль писать нужно? Или как вообще здесь ... я просто хотел бы сократить время изучение, возможно есть доброволец кто просто подскажет от куда начать в моей ситуации чтоб достигнуть нужного мне результата. Ну а там попутно разбираться буду. Спасибо за то что вы есть

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.